MEMORANDUM OPINION AND ORDER

ALBRITTON, Chief Judge.

On October 4, 1993, Petitioner George Everette Sibley, Jr. was convicted in the Circuit Court of Lee County, Alabama, of capital murder. He was sentenced to death by the court following a unanimous recommendation of the jury. On September 30, 2002, the Supreme Court of Alabama set an execution date of November 7, 2002.
